Remove VX LCA's
Remove Downpipe
Install swaybar
Install downpipe
Install Integra LCA's
and most importantly
BUY A HELMS

jeff652: Thanks for the information and I never thought I had to remove the downpipe. I've already got the JDM ITR LCAs at all four corners and where can I get a Helms manual.
The swaybar snakes above the exhaust stuff, and actually ow that I think abou it the linkage too, so you have to remove at least one end of the linkage. Not that big of a deal, but the helms makes it very clear . . .
